Matlab中mex, mexcuda和nvcc编译的不同
1. mex: 既是一个路径名称也是一个函数名称,作为函数,其作用是编译并链接源文件到一个共享的库中(shared library),这个共享的库称为mex-file,可以在MATLAB中运行,为单独的MATLAb引擎和MAT文件应用构建可执行程序,可以看作是matlab execute(mex)的简写。2. mexcuda:编译一个mex-function用于GPU计算。具体为编译并链接源文件到一个shared library中,这个共享库称为mex-file,可以在MATLAB中运行。mexcuda
原创
2020-08-10 23:42:43 ·
1182 阅读 ·
0 评论